Abnormal heating at a B-phase feeder breaker in a hotel distribution panel
Abnormal heating at the B-phase termination of a feeder breaker in a hotel distribution panel, consistent with a possible loose or compromised connection.
What was found
Thermal imaging identified abnormal heating at the B-phase termination of a feeder breaker inside a distribution panel at a high-end hotel. That breaker feeds a smaller downstream panel serving the hotel kitchen. The observed heating pattern is consistent with increased resistance at the termination, possibly from a loose or otherwise compromised connection. The exact condition was not disassembled and verified at the time of the scan, so further evaluation is recommended to determine the exact condition.
Why it mattered
The affected breaker supplied a downstream 120/208V panel serving the hotel kitchen.
Potential consequences
Continued degradation at the connection could interrupt power to equipment and circuits supplied by that kitchen panel, creating operational disruption.
Recommendation
Inspect, disassemble, clean and reassemble to proper component torque.
